WD My Cloud Review . The My Cloud range is a line of external 2. TB, 3. TB and 4. TB hard drives determined to pick a fight with both traditional NAS and Cloud storage services like Dropbox and Google Drive. They support traditional NAS features via a browser- based dashboard and DLNA support, while apps let you access your drive remotely via PCs, smartphones and tablets just like popular cloud services. This means you have a much bigger storage allowance than standard Cloud services, your data isn’t shared with another company and you only have to upload what you need with no monthly subscriptions.
WD also claims the My Cloud performs faster than most NAS drives for a fraction of the price. Is this a breakthrough product or too good to be true? WD My Cloud – Design. The roots of the My Cloud come from WD’s existing My Book range of backup hard drives. This is no bad thing.

Over the years WD has refined the My Book design and it translates well to My Cloud with subtle rounded corners and a clean, minimalist finish that suggests it could’ve come off an Apple product line. The fact WD has released My Cloud in white is not an insignificant factor. For a multi- function device My Cloud is also very compact.

If we do have an issue with the My Cloud design it is that its chassis isn’t particularly rigid, but since this is a device unlikely to move, let alone be carried with you, it isn’t a major issue. With 2. TB, 3. TB and (soon) 4. TB versions My Cloud is as capacious as any single drive backup solution currently available.

Tunes servers, UPn. P, and FTP (though the latter is disabled by default) plus multi- user support to set folder access and permissions. Meanwhile it gains its Cloud storage (and more advanced NAS) credentials thanks to remote file access via Android (above), i. OS, PC and Mac apps. These support file downloads, edits and media streaming. The restriction is the apps have no integrated media player so playback is limited to formats your device supports.
This isn’t a problem for Windows or Android, but is a significant drawback for i. OS. On the upside, the mobile apps bring support for Google Drive, Dropbox and Sky. Drive letting users transfer and sync content between your .

But, as with any multifunctional device, there are limitations. The most obvious is being a single drive system means the My Cloud can back up your data, but not itself.

The Ready. NAS system uses a Netgear version of RAID called X- RAID that creates a balance between reliability and capacity which also supports automatic expansion of the system as one adds additional drives.

My Book Live Duo is disconnected, it will resume automatically once the computer is available. If you change the name of the My Book Live Duo, previously set Time Machine backups delay or fail.
To fix the problem, resume backing up by re- selecting the drive in the Time Machine Preferences screen.
